It can be observed that in the short term (2–4 and 4–8 day period band) there is no consistency in results; in some cases the null hypothesis can be rejected and in some cases it cannot. In the medium term there is more consistency in rejection of the null hypothesis in favour of bubble regime coherence values significantly exceeding the non-bubble regime values. In the long term, the proportion of instances exhibiting statistical significance reduces, with the majority of cases in the 256–512 band not being a rejection of the null hypothesis. This reduction of statistically significant differences when considering longer term periods further emphasises the point that it is the medium term in which coherences tend to strengthen during bubble regimes.

There are thousands of different cryptocurrencies available today. The most popular — and the original — is Bitcoin, which was created in 2009. Other common cryptocurrencies include Ethereum, XRP, and Bitcoin Cash. Each of these currencies serves a different purpose, with some optimized for use in place of cash, and others designed for private, direct transactions.

A cryptocurrency monetary policy is enforced through a unique blend of software, cryptography and financial incentives rather than the whim of trusted third parties such as central banks, corporations or governments. Cryptocurrencies are powered by cryptographically secure, verifiable transaction databases called blockchains, which provide their security and transparency.
